Nacky - Snowland.net
Nacky(Issei Ishii)がDJ/Composerのようなふりして書き散らすblogサイト
Jump to navigation
«Prev ||
1 |
2 |
3 |
4 ||
Next»
2009-09-14
WinSCPでUTF-8な相手に接続するとファイル名が文字化けしている.
サーバ側はUTF-8使用,でもWinSCPはShift_JISなんだそうな.
セッションの設定画面で環境を開いて
「ファイル名をUTF-8でエンコード」をオフにすれば良い的な記述を見つけるが,グレーアウトしとる.
よく見たらSFTPのときのみ有効で,SCPではダメみたい.
でまぁ,sshが通るならSCPじゃなくてもSFTPも通るよね,ということでSFTPに変更.
先ほどのオプションを「自動」から「オフ」に変更.しかしまだ化ける.
「オン」にしたら化けなくなった.
ぐぐって見つけたのと違ったが,バージョンアップ中に逆になったのかもしれんな.
(手元のバージョンは4.1.9でした)
そんなわけで解決.
2009-09-01
postgresqlで全文検索!
ということで実験がてらインストール.
CentOS5.3+pgdgからもってきたpostgresql8.3.7
■
Install - Ludia Wiki
もうこの解説通りにすんなりと…いかねぇorz
■
PostgreSQL 8.3.6 に ludia を入れた: 表参道ではたらくCTOのブログ
やはり同じくIndexBuildHeapScanの引数問題でひっかかる.
第6引数にfalseを指定して通してやる.
とりあえずこれで通りました.
たまにconnectionが切れちゃったりしたんだけど,おさまった…?
うーむ,まだ実験レベルだなぁ.
2009-08-25
・CentOS5.3でwebminからSambaのユーザーをいじりたい
・デフォルトでsamba入れてwebmin入れてもsambaでアクセスできない
→認証がtdbsamになってるので,pdbeditでパスワードを変更しないとアクセスできません
webminがpdbeditを使ってくれるようにするには
・webmin を開く
・サーバ>Samba Windowsファイル共有 を開く
・モジュール設定(左上)を開く
・pdbeditのパスを設定 /usr/bin/pdbedit
これでsambaユーザーの設定のときにpdbeditが使われるようになります.
2009-05-28
cgiを設置してあげるときによくあること(?)
前にもちょっとひっかかったけど今日もひっかかったのでメモ.
■cgiにアクセスしても403 forbidden
→cgiに実行権限がない.適当にchmod +x してやる.
→ExecCGIが無効.httpd.confや.htaccessでOptions +ExecCGI してやる.
■cgiにアクセスしたら500 Internal Server Error
apacheのerror_logに
(2)No such file or directory: exec of 'hoge.cgi' failed
と残っている
→perlとかの場合最初の行の #!/usr/bin/perl のパスが合ってないとか
→改行コードがCRLFになってる(perlのパスを理解できてない.#!/usr/bin/perl\r と読めるっぽい)
■他
httpd.confのAddHandler cgi-script .cgi .pl 行が有効になってないパターンもあった.
他にも色々あるでしょうけど,よく遭遇するパターンはコレ.
2009-02-18
■
[24時間365日] サーバ/インフラを支える技術 ~スケーラビリティ、ハイパフォーマンス、省力運用 (WEB+DB PRESS plusシリーズ) (WEB+DB PRESS plusシリーズ)
止められないサービス,しかし障害は起きる…さてどうやって運用するんだか!
自宅サーバ程度,社内の軽度のイントラサーバ程度なら適当にPC-UNIXをつっこんで運用できるが,さてサービス本番サーバとなると…あれ,どうやってんの?
というような部分を解説してくれた本.
高いサーバパーツがなくてもソフトウェアでなんとかできたりするあたりとか,見ていて楽しい!
工夫の仕方は色々あるのだろうけど,一種の定石本,みたいな感じになるのかな?
«Prev ||
1 |
2 |
3 |
4 ||
Next»